I’m one of those suckers who uses predictive text on their mobile phone to supposedly speed up the process of sending SMS messages.

Unfortunately, it doesn’t always work, especially if you have to input a word which wasn’t programmed in to the phone at time of manufacture.

Which is usually the case with swear words, and the first time you use them, you have to go through the rigmarole of typing them in.

This video shows why, with Armstrong & Miller playing the two learned types who are in charge of deciding which words get included and which don’t.
